import { isAbortError, spawnCommand } from './commands-runner';
import { getVenvPythonPath } from './virtual-environment';
import { PythonExecutable, Version, getPythonExecutable } from './detect-python';
import { OS, detectOs } from './detect-os';
import { createVenv, checkActivatedVenv } from './virtual-environment';
import { upgradePip, installRequirements } from './pip';
import { ProxyEnv, getProxyEnv } from './proxy';
import { ServerStateController } from './server-state-controller';
import { ServerStatus, ServerStartingStage } from '@shared/server-state';
import { EXTENSION_SERVER_DISPLAY_NAME } from '../constants';
import { LogOutputChannel, window } from 'vscode';
import { join } from 'path';
import { MODEL_NAME_TO_ID_MAP, ModelName } from '@shared/model';
import { extensionState } from '../state';
import { clearLruCache } from '../lru-cache.decorator';
import { DEVICE_NAME_TO_ID_MAP, DeviceName } from '@shared/device';
const SERVER_STARTED_STDOUT_ANCHOR = 'OpenVINO Code Server started';
interface ServerHooks {
onStarted: () => void;
}
async function runServer(modelName: ModelName, deviceName: DeviceName, config: PythonServerConfiguration, hooks?: ServerHooks) {
const { serverDir, proxyEnv, abortSignal, logger } = config;
logger.info('Starting server...');
const venvPython = await getVenvPythonPath(config);
let started = false;
function stdoutListener(data: string) {
if (started) {
return;
}
if (data.includes(SERVER_STARTED_STDOUT_ANCHOR)) {
hooks?.onStarted();
started = true;
logger.info('Server started');
}
}
const model = MODEL_NAME_TO_ID_MAP[modelName];
const device = DEVICE_NAME_TO_ID_MAP[deviceName];
await spawnCommand(venvPython, ['main.py', '--model', model, '--device', device], {
logger,
cwd: serverDir,
abortSignal,
env: { ...proxyEnv },
listeners: { stdout: stdoutListener },
});
}
const logger = window.createOutputChannel(EXTENSION_SERVER_DISPLAY_NAME, { log: true });
const SERVER_DIR = join(__dirname, 'server');
export interface PythonServerConfiguration {
python: PythonExecutable;
os: OS;
venvDirName: string;
serverDir: string;
proxyEnv?: ProxyEnv;
abortSignal: AbortSignal;
logger: LogOutputChannel;
}
export class NativePythonServerRunner {
static readonly REQUIRED_PYTHON_VERSION: Version = [3, 8];
static readonly VENV_DIR_NAME = '.venv';
private _abortController = new AbortController();
private readonly _stateController = new ServerStateController();
get stateReporter() {
return this._stateController.reporter;
}
async start() {
if (this._stateController.state.status === ServerStatus.STARTED) {
logger.info('Server is already started. Skipping start command');
return;
}
this._stateController.setStatus(ServerStatus.STARTING);
try {
logger.info('Starting Server using python virtual environment...');
await this._start();
} catch (e) {
const error = e instanceof Error ? e : new Error(String(e));
if (isAbortError(error)) {
logger.debug('Server launch was aborted');
return;
}
logger.error(`Server stopped with error:`);
logger.error(error);
} finally {
this._stateController.setStage(null);
this._stateController.setStatus(ServerStatus.STOPPED);
logger.info('Server stopped');
}
}
async _start() {
clearLruCache();
const os = detectOs();
logger.info(`System detected: ${os}`);
this._stateController.setStage(ServerStartingStage.DETECT_SYSTEM_PYTHON);
const python: PythonExecutable = await getPythonExecutable(
NativePythonServerRunner.REQUIRED_PYTHON_VERSION,
logger
);
const proxyEnv = getProxyEnv();
if (proxyEnv) {
logger.info('Applying proxy settings:');
logger.info(JSON.stringify(proxyEnv, null, 2));
}
const config: PythonServerConfiguration = {
python,
os,
proxyEnv,
serverDir: SERVER_DIR,
venvDirName: NativePythonServerRunner.VENV_DIR_NAME,
abortSignal: this._abortController.signal,
logger,
};
this._stateController.setStage(ServerStartingStage.CREATE_VENV);
await createVenv(config);
this._stateController.setStage(ServerStartingStage.CHECK_VENV_ACTIVATION);
await checkActivatedVenv(config);
this._stateController.setStage(ServerStartingStage.UPGRADE_PIP);
await upgradePip(config);
this._stateController.setStage(ServerStartingStage.INSTALL_REQUIREMENTS);
await installRequirements(config);
this._stateController.setStage(ServerStartingStage.START_SERVER);
const modelName = extensionState.config.model;
const deviceName = extensionState.config.device;
await runServer(modelName, deviceName, config, {
onStarted: () => {
this._stateController.setStatus(ServerStatus.STARTED);
this._stateController.setStage(null);
},
});
}
stop() {
logger.info('Stopping...');
this._abortController.abort();
this._abortController = new AbortController();
}
}
